
Katihar to Bharuch
Bharuch is approximately 1700+ kms from Katihar. The fastest way to reach Bharuch from Katihar is by Train Via Katni. It takes approximately 36 hours. The cheapest way to reach Bharuch from Katihar is by Train Via Ratlam which would take approximately 36 hours.
Sort By
Mode of Transport
Via Katni
RECOMMENDED
FASTEST
Katihar
Katni
Bharuch
Approx Travel Time
1d 11h 25m
₹825
Onwards
Via Jabalpur
Katihar
Jabalpur
Bharuch
Approx Travel Time
1d 11h 40m
₹815
Onwards
Via Prayagraj(Allahabad)
Katihar
Prayagraj(Allahabad)
Bharuch
Approx Travel Time
1d 11h 55m
₹830
Onwards
Via Satna
Katihar
Satna
Bharuch
Approx Travel Time
1d 11h 25m
₹835
Onwards
Via Itarsi
Katihar
Itarsi
Bharuch
Approx Travel Time
1d 11h 25m
₹780
Onwards
Via Varanasi
Katihar
Varanasi
Bharuch
Approx Travel Time
1d 11h 55m
₹910
Onwards
Via Kanpur
Katihar
Kanpur
Bharuch
Approx Travel Time
1d 13h 25m
₹605
Onwards
Via Pipariya
Katihar
Pipariya
Bharuch
Approx Travel Time
1d 11h 40m
₹790
Onwards
Via Ratlam
CHEAPEST
Katihar
Ratlam
Bharuch
Approx Travel Time
1d 11h 55m
₹565
Onwards
Via Khachrod
Katihar
Khachrod
Bharuch
Approx Travel Time
1d 12h 10m
On Demand
Frequently Asked Questions
What is the distance between Katihar and Bharuch?
Bharuch is approximately 1700+ kms from Katihar.
How long does it take to reach Bharuch from Katihar?
It takes approximately 36 hours to reach Bharuch from Katihar by Train Via Katni.
What is the cheapest way to reach Bharuch from Katihar?
The cheapest way to reach Bharuch from Katihar is by Train Via Ratlam.
What is the fastest way to reach Bharuch from Katihar?
The fastest way to reach Bharuch from Katihar is by Train Via Katni.